I've always been more attached to Windows because it gives me a better experience overall than Mac but I've always wanted to develop apps for iOS. As of now I only have a Windows computer and am trying to find IDE's in place of XCode which will allow me to develop iOS apps. Can anyone suggest a few that might work?

The short answer... there isn't one. iOS apps can only be done with iOS software.
I have seen and read in the forums that there are some ways of installing a type of 'virtual mac' on a windows machine, but I'm not sure.
